📖 Abstract

Generation of energy in form of electric power is susceptible of vanishing threat due to high dependency on hydrocarbon fuel (e.g. oil). Energy management system (EMS) standards (e.g. ISO 50001) are developed for supporting the efficiency of concurrent generation means. In this paper, analytical study is performed for evaluating worthiness of EMS in various organizations including power production industry. Data of ISO enlighten EMS in various global organizations are obtained from clean energy ministerial (CEM). Results found that only 2.69 % of total global power production industries are using the EMS standards. The major number of EMS costumers are found to be end users including the manufacturers and retailers.
